While I agree that it was not an action packed episode, I don't agree that it was a boring one. As a matter of fact I thought that it was a very interesting and well written one with a very powerful underlying message to it. We are seeing individual character development from week to week. The bottom line is that the characters are learning to make the transition from PRE-apocalyptic life to POST-apocalyptic life.

Beth, in her wanting to finally try a drink, eventually made Daryl realize that it is time to move forward and "burn" away the memories and feelings of pre-apocalyptic life.....hence burning down the building and saying "F--K you to the old memories of the old way of life that have been torturing these people.

She herself realized that while she may have not been a force in the group, she was a survivor and was still alive. She also made Daryl realize that he was a valued member of the group in that he has saved many lives and is a powerful leader and survivor.

On another note, how great was the scene when they were locked in the trunk waiting for the herd of walkers to go by? One second quiet and the next like a sound of explosion and spiraling confusion! The writers did an excellent job making the viewer feel like Daryl and Beth were feeling at that moment.
